The Toyota Starlet, a compact hatchback produced between 1985 and 1990, is a classic example of Japanese engineering from the late 20th century. Designed as a practical and economical vehicle, the Starlet falls under the B-class category, making it ideal for urban commuting and small families. With its 3-door hatchback body type, the car offers a balance of functionality and simplicity. The Starlet's lightweight design and efficient petrol engine make it a reliable choice for those seeking a no-frills, dependable vehicle.
Under the hood, the Toyota Starlet is powered by a 1.0-liter, 3-cylinder petrol engine that delivers 55 horsepower at 6000 rpm. The carburetor-based fuel system ensures straightforward maintenance, while the in-line cylinder arrangement and 4 valves per cylinder contribute to its smooth performance. With a maximum torque of 102 N*m at 3500 rpm, the Starlet provides adequate power for city driving. The 4-speed manual transmission and front-wheel drive further enhance its maneuverability, making it a nimble car for tight urban spaces.
The Toyota Starlet's compact dimensions—3700 mm in length, 1590 mm in width, and 1400 mm in height—make it easy to park and navigate through crowded streets. Its 2300 mm wheelbase ensures stability, while the 165 mm ground clearance allows for comfortable driving on uneven roads. The independent front suspension with spring support provides a smooth ride, and the front disc brakes offer reliable stopping power. The Toyota Starlet has several advantages, including its fuel efficiency, compact size, and ease of maintenance. Its simple carburetor engine and mechanical transmission are cost-effective to repair, and the car's lightweight design contributes to its excellent fuel economy. However, the Starlet's modest power output and lack of modern features, such as turbocharging or advanced safety systems, may be seen as drawbacks for some buyers. Additionally, its production ended in 1990, meaning finding spare parts could be challenging.
